📜  Node.js 日期和时间 Date.addSeconds() 方法(1)

📅  最后修改于: 2023-12-03 15:33:10.840000             🧑  作者: Mango

Node.js 日期和时间 Date.addSeconds() 方法

JavaScript 中的日期和时间是常见的处理和显示方式,Node.js 通过内置的 Date 对象提供了对日期和时间的支持。Date 的 addSeconds() 方法允许程序员向指定日期加上秒数(单位为秒)。

语法

addSeconds() 方法的语法如下:

dateObject.addSeconds(seconds)

其中,dateObject 表示要操作的日期对象(必选),seconds 表示要添加的秒数(必选)。

返回值

该方法会返回一个新的 Date 对象,代表添加指定秒数后的日期。

示例

以下示例将向当前日期增加 10 秒,并输出增加后的日期。

const date = new Date();
const newDate = date.addSeconds(10);
console.log(newDate);

输出结果如下:

2022-07-08T02:54:10.849Z
注意事项
  • addSeconds() 方法不会修改原日期对象,而是返回一个新的日期对象。
  • seconds 参数可以为任意数字,包括正数、负数和 0,表示分别向前、向后、不变更日期。
  • 如果向日期添加的秒数为小数,则会将其转换为整数进行处理。
  • 使用 addSeconds() 方法时,需要注意新创建的日期对象和原日期对象的时区。建议使用 UTC 来处理日期和时间,避免时区转换带来的麻烦。

以上就是 Node.js 日期和时间 Date.addSeconds() 方法的介绍。